Overview
- Kickoff is 1 p.m. ET at MetLife Stadium, and both teams have been eliminated from playoff contention.
- Minnesota enters 6-8 on a two-game win streak, with J.J. McCarthy throwing multiple touchdowns in each of the past two games and adding a rushing score against Dallas.
- New York is 2-12 with eight straight losses and currently holds the projected No. 1 pick in the 2026 NFL Draft.
- Brian Flores’ defense is cited as one of the better units this season, though reports note the Vikings could be without pass rusher Jonathan Greenard.
- Quarterback matchups and props draw focus, with Giants rookie Jaxson Dart’s rushing (six 50+ yard games, 400 yards and seven TDs) highlighted, while predictions split between a CBS model leaning Giants and several analysts backing Minnesota.
